Output 96bad4e9acc908051fa546bcc0ea8c48ec05e8c1bcdcd2b1e8217bedc53708a1:1

value
88981666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b66b6450da49fb0bdebcbdcabf9120421360443 OP_EQUAL
address
34BuDH3YKenfNhde15gzaDpNLvDWSBctMC
transaction
96bad4e9acc908051fa546bcc0ea8c48ec05e8c1bcdcd2b1e8217bedc53708a1
spent
true